How Much Is a Pound of Pennies Worth? A pound of pennies produced from the design launched in 1982 is worth $1.81, containing 181 pennies at 2.5 grams each. Pennies minted from 1962 to 1982 contain less copper in the plating. Based on a weight of 3.11 grams each, a pound of those pennies is worth about $1.45. Historical Aluminum Prices per Pound. The pound is a unit of currency in some nations. The term originated in the Frankish Empire as a result of Charlemagne's currency reform ("pound" from Latin pondus, a unit of weight) and was subsequently taken to Great Britain as the value of a pound (weight) of silver. Less than a pound (£) Shilling and pennies "Bob" is slang for shilling (which is 5p in todays money) 1 shilling equalled twelve pence (12d).. £1 (one pound) equalled 20 shillings (20s or 20/-)240 pennies ( 240d ) = £1. There were 240 pennies to a pound because originally 240 silver penny coins weighed 1 pound (1lb). Common names for the British Pound include the Pound Sterling, Sterling, Quid, Cable, and Nicker. Social Media · Mobile Apps · LinkLB · Speak Up LB  It would take 454 $20 bills to make a pound, for a grand total of $9,080. The Beginnings of the $20 Bill. In the early days of the United States, colonies printed their own money, and states later did the same thing. The original colonies modeled their currency after British money, but shortly after the Revolution, the United States decided to issue its own currency. A dollar bill is approximately 1 gram. As this site observes, that makes 454 bills per pound, not per ounce. So, 454*$20 = $9080. Your dad should have asked for a pound of C-notes
